I purchased this Jeep new in 1989. It is a 2 wheel drive, which I have lowered 2 inches, and installed ground effects from Archer Racing. It has a 6 cylinder, 4.0 liter engine with 68,000 original miles. Original interior, includes bucket seats and a 5-speed manual transmission. Painted with 89 Viper red and painted Rhino Lining to match. This truck is a real head turner and has won many awards at various car shows!

That stuff looks like 100% generic/universal stuff.  I don't care enough to do any legwork, so hold that against me if you want, but check if they say those parts fit the S10/Dakota/Ranger/Courier/Mazda Bs/whatever other mini trucks, that will tell you right away it's just a generic part.

 

Also, remember, aftermarket parts ONLY fit the box they come in.  And that's a best case scenario.
